Tribes by Seth Godin – Book Summary
“Tribes” by Seth Godin is a compelling exploration of how small groups of committed individuals, or “tribes,” can drive significant change in society. Godin emphasizes the power of leadership in these communities, urging readers to embrace their roles as leaders and to harness the potential of tribes to create meaningful movements. With the rise of digital platforms, building and leading tribes has never been more accessible, making this book a vital read for anyone looking to make a difference.
7 Key Lessons and Takeaways
- Leadership Is for Everyone: Leadership isn’t limited to a select few; anyone with passion and a vision can lead.
- Tribes Are Everywhere: Whether you realize it or not, you’re already part of a tribe—now, you can choose to lead it.
- Focus on Connection, Not Numbers: The strength of a tribe lies in the depth of its connections, not its size.
- Challenge the Status Quo: True leaders are heretics who question norms and push for innovation.
- Leverage Digital Tools: The internet makes it easier than ever to build and lead tribes that can drive change.
- Tell a Compelling Story: Movements thrive on powerful narratives that resonate with a tribe’s core beliefs.
- Action Beats Inaction: Don’t wait for permission; take initiative and lead your tribe toward your vision.

The Book Summary in 10 Minutes
Unlock the Power of Tribes to Forge a Brighter Future
In today’s noisy world, standing out and making a difference requires more than just attracting attention; it demands cultivating a dedicated tribe around your message or cause. Seth Godin argues that trying to appeal to everyone leads to mediocrity. Instead, focus on building a tribe that shares a passion for a cause, fostering loyalty and driving real change. Tribes are powerful because they unite individuals around a shared purpose, enabling them to challenge the status quo and make a lasting impact.
Discover the Tribe You’re Already a Part of
Humans have always gravitated towards tribes—groups bound by religion, ethnicity, politics, or shared interests. Godin defines a tribe as a group of people connected by a common cause and a leader who embodies that cause. For example, Wikipedia thrives because of a tribe of dedicated contributors led by Jimmy Wales. The internet has amplified the reach and influence of tribes, allowing them to connect and grow across the globe. A tribe’s impact is determined not by its size but by its commitment to its cause and its ability to communicate effectively.
Create for the Few, Captivate the Many
The era of broad, mass-market appeal is over. Success now lies in creating something exceptional for a specific group, as exemplified by Apple’s focus on a niche market with the iPhone. By crafting a product that resonates deeply with a select few, Apple built a passionate tribe that fueled its success. In today’s world, people seek more than just generic offerings; they crave connection and belonging. By focusing on creating something truly unique for a distinct group, you can build a tribe that drives a movement.
Igniting Change: How to Build and Lead Your Own Tribe with Today’s Tech
The digital age has democratized influence, making it easier than ever to build and lead a tribe. The key to a thriving tribe is not just communication from the leader but also among the members. Platforms like Basecamp and Twitter facilitate this horizontal dialogue, allowing tribes to grow organically. The success of CrossFit illustrates how digital tools can help build a global community around a shared passion. By leveraging these tools, you can unite your tribe and ignite change.
The Blueprint of a Movement: From Yearning to Transformation
A movement doesn’t require millions; it starts with a small group of passionate individuals. Godin argues that a mere 1,000 true believers can spark a movement. The key is to tap into an existing desire and channel it into a collective pursuit. Al Gore’s “An Inconvenient Truth” didn’t introduce the idea of global warming but galvanized a global community ready to act. By telling a compelling story, fostering connections within your tribe, and taking action, you can transform an idea into a movement.
Fostering Intimacy: The True Strength of a Tribe
The power of a tribe lies not in its size but in the strength of its connections. Unlike traditional marketing, which is one-way, tribes thrive on multi-directional communication. Strengthening these internal connections is crucial for solidifying a tribe. Creating a sense of insider culture, as Apple did, can enhance the tribe’s unity and identity. As a leader, focus on fostering these connections to build a strong, cohesive tribe.
True Leadership: Filling the Void and Igniting Change
Leadership is about stepping into the unknown and rallying others around a vision for change. It requires courage to challenge the status quo and forge a new path. Leadership is not about fame or charisma; it’s about authenticity and generosity. Leaders like Al Gore and Shepard Fairey succeeded because they were committed to their cause and willing to share their resources freely. True leadership is about making a meaningful contribution and inspiring others to join you in the pursuit of change.

About the Author
Seth Godin is an American author, entrepreneur, and marketer, known as one of the most influential voices in business and marketing. He has written more than ten international bestsellers, including “Purple Cow,” “All Marketers Are Liars,” and “Linchpin.” Godin is also recognized as the world’s most successful business blogger, and his work has been translated into over 35 languages. Through his books and blog, Godin continues to inspire millions to think differently about leadership, marketing, and innovation.
